What moderation delivers

A moderator’s job is not to fill time. It is to make a panel useful to the people listening. That means real preparation with the speakers ahead of the event, real questions in the room, and the willingness to move a conversation forward when a panellist drifts.

The work has a recognisable shape:

  • Pre-event prep: speaker interviews, sharper framings, an agreed flow that lets each speaker do their best work
  • In-room moderation: real questions, not list-checking. Time discipline that respects both speakers and audience. The redirection a panel sometimes needs
  • Audience participation: questions calibrated to the room, not generic placeholders
  • Post-event reflection: a short note to the organiser on what landed, what did not, and what would sharpen the next one
